It’s time to reap the rewards for the proud users of Samsung Nexus S 4G (a CDMA flagship device from Google) with the incoming news in the market about the leaking of Android 4.04 IMM763 update for their phones in the web.

The folks at Briefmobile were the ones to share the news, rather good news for them as they glimpsed and got a hand on the ICS ROM file for the Nexus S 4G much ahead of the OTA rolling out data. And really there is every reason to believe that the leaked file is none other than that the official android 4.04 IMM763 which is to be indulged into the Samsung Nexus S 4G device. Though the release of the update is still not fixed as the adventurous type may take the advantage of the leaked ICS ROM.
